[ 
https://issues.apache.org/jira/browse/THRIFT-1603?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13574829#comment-13574829
 ] 

Jens Geyer commented on THRIFT-1603:
------------------------------------

{quote}[...] since it's a vector not a dictionary{quote}

Indeed. At least that explains why it is working. :-)

{quote}Insertion Speed [...] is it worth the trouble?{quote}

Agree, absolutely. Don't think this is a problem.
                
> Thrift IDL allows for multiple exceptions, args or struct member names to be 
> the same
> -------------------------------------------------------------------------------------
>
>                 Key: THRIFT-1603
>                 URL: https://issues.apache.org/jira/browse/THRIFT-1603
>             Project: Thrift
>          Issue Type: Bug
>         Environment: RedHat 5.5, C++, thrift-0.8.0
>            Reporter: Michael Popovich
>            Assignee: Kamil Sałaś
>            Priority: Trivial
>             Fix For: 1.0
>
>         Attachments: 
> 0001-Thrift-1603-Provide-unique-names-for-t_struct-elemen.patch
>
>
> I noticed that the Thrift IDL compiler allows for multiple exceptions 
> instances to utilize the same name... This is a problem because when 
> compiling to C++, the generated C++ code will not compile properly:
> service whatever
> {
> void insert(1: string s) throws (1: NS nst, WX wxx, NSTx nst),
> }

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ira

Reply via email to